Apple vs. the FBI, with Megan Zavieh
Ethics lawyer Megan Zavieh made no bones about it, lawyers should support Apple in its fight against the FBI.
Well, now the pleadings are in, but the court has yet to decide. While we wait, Megan breaks down the case and what it means for ordinary Americans, including lawyers and their clients.
